The location in Bishop’s Stortford is a core attraction. The town offers a variety of shops, cafés, restaurants and services, with a central high street area providing day-to-day conveniences as well as independent and national retailers. Local parks and open spaces, such as Castle Gardens and Grange Paddocks, are within easy reach by foot or car, providing riverside walks, play areas and sports facilities.
For families, Bishop’s Stortford is well regarded for its schools, and this address sits within reach of some of the town’s top Ofsted-rated catchments, making it an appealing choice for buyers prioritising access to education.
Transport links are a further strength. Bishop’s Stortford railway station provides mainline services to London Liverpool Street, Stansted Airport and Cambridge. Typical journey times to London Liverpool Street are around 40–45 minutes, with Stansted Airport reachable in approximately 10 minutes by train. The station is accessible from the property by a short drive or a longer walk, depending on preference. Road connections are excellent, with access to the M11 and A120 enabling routes towards London, Cambridge and the wider region.
